Gas biofuels
Gas is a major energy source in Australia, used for about 25% of energy supply and some electricity generation. It is especially important for industrial processes that need very high heat.
Biogas is a renewable gas made from organic waste. It can be used to produce electricity, heat, and steam. It can also be upgraded into biomethane, which is very similar to natural gas.
Biomethane:
- can replace natural gas
- works with existing gas systems
- can be used as fuel for trucks and heavy vehicles.
Biogas can be produced by:
- breaking down organic material (anaerobic digestion)
- processing waste and wastewater
- capturing gas from landfill.
Although Queensland does not yet have large-scale production, this technology is widely used in Europe and the United States.
Biogas and biomethane can:
- lower energy costs for businesses
- provide renewable energy to communities
- improve waste management
- increase energy security.
